Festo Series MS Replacement Filter Element, 1μm Filtration size - MS9-LFM-B, Numeric Part Number: 553037


This replacement filter element is designed to fit seamlessly within the MS series of Festo products, providing high-efficiency filtration for various industrial applications. With a filtration capability of 1μm, this element ensures effective removal of contaminants, contributing to the longevity of associated components. The use of borosilicate fibre as the filtering material enhances its reliability and performance under varying conditions.

What is the significance of the filtration size in this filter element?


The 1μm filtration size is critical for effectively capturing small particles, preventing wear and tear on sensitive components in pneumatic systems. This level of filtration maximises system efficiency and reliability.

How does the corrosion resistance class affect the choice of this filter?


The CRC 2 classification indicates that the filter can withstand moderate corrosion stress, making it suitable for applications in mildly aggressive environments where traditional filters may fail.

Can this filter be used in high-temperature environments?


While the filter is designed for various conditions, it is essential to consult specific guidelines and performance criteria as high temperatures may affect the filtration efficiency and the overall lifespan of the element.

How often should the filter element be replaced for optimal performance?


Replacement intervals depend on the operational environment and contaminant levels but typically range from every few weeks to several months. Monitoring performance and flow rates can help determine the best schedule for replacement.
